java—如何在spring中使用依赖注入将传递值的类属性分配给类构造函数?

wmvff8tz  于 2021-06-30  发布在  Java
关注(0)|答案(1)|浏览(191)

我对Spring有点陌生。我需要使用构造函数为我的类属性赋值。我使用spring依赖注入中的类构造函数方法来实现这一点。如何配置bean xml来实现这一点。

t5zmwmid

t5zmwmid1#

mybean1.等级:

public class MyBean1{
      private MyBean2 bean2;
      public MyBean1(MyBean2 bean2){
         this.bean2=bean2;
      }
  }

xml格式:

<!-- Definition for bean1 -->
   <bean id = "bean1" class = "com.MyBean1">
      <constructor-arg ref = "bean2"/>
   </bean>

   <!-- Definition for bean2 -->
   <bean id = "bean2" class = "com.MyBean2"></bean>

相关问题